🧑💼 Eligibility Criteria for Peon Vacancy 2025
✅ Educational Qualification:
- Minimum: 8th Pass or 10th Pass
- Preferred: 10th Pass with basic communication skills
✅ Age Limit:
- Minimum Age: 18 Years
- Maximum Age: 40 Years (age relaxation for SC/ST/OBC as per govt norms)
✅ Physical Fitness:
- Candidate must be physically fit to carry out tasks like cleaning, lifting files, or running errands.
💰 Salary and Allowances
Peon jobs offer decent pay with job security. Here’s an approximate salary breakdown:
Component | Amount (Monthly) |
---|---|
Basic Pay | ₹15,000 – ₹18,000 |
DA (Dearness Allowance) | ₹2,000 – ₹4,000 |
HRA (House Rent) | ₹1,000 – ₹2,000 |
Other Allowances | ₹500 – ₹1,000 |
Total Salary | ₹18,000 – ₹25,000 |
In government jobs, ESI, PF, Pension, and Medical Benefits are also included.

🔍 Selection Process
The recruitment process for peon jobs may include:
- Merit-Based Shortlisting (based on 10th marks)
- Written Exam (basic math, general knowledge)
- Interview / Document Verification
- Physical Test (rare cases)
In most state-level jobs, direct recruitment based on merit is common for Peon posts.

🙋 FAQs on Peon Recruitment 2025
Q1. Can I apply for peon jobs without experience?
➡️ Yes, most peon jobs do not require any prior experience.
Q2. Is there a written exam for peon jobs?
➡️ Some departments conduct basic written tests; others may go for direct merit-based recruitment.
Q3. Can females apply for peon vacancies?
➡️ Yes, there is no gender restriction unless specified in the job notice.
Q4. Is online application compulsory?
➡️ Depends on the department. Some prefer postal applications while others offer online mode.
Q5. What is the work of a peon?
➡️ Tasks include carrying files, delivering messages, maintaining office cleanliness, and basic errands.
